PREVOST FACTORY TOUR

Royale Coach Club members will have an opportunity to tour the Prevost factory this fall. After the PEI rally concludes, there will be two days available to travel from PEI to Quebec City. It is about 560 miles; approximately 10 hours total driving time. The campgrounds along the way may be closed at that time of year, but there are three Walmart's on the route. We plan to have a "Potluck Dinner" on Monday evening at the campground's meeting room, if you would like to participate.

On Tuesday, September 12th, Prevost will pick us up at the Quebec campground and host a tour of their factory in Sainte-Claire, Quebec.

After Tuesday's tour, you may plan to spend some additional days and visit other attractions in the Quebec area. This year is Canada's 150th birthday, and there are lots of activities planned throughout 2017, particularly in Quebec City.
